Description
circular, the sides of the hinged lid decorated with chased laurel-framed ovals alternating with rose gold flowerheads on a sablé ground, bright-cut gold two-coloured gold borders, maker’s mark, charge and discharge mark of Jean-Baptiste Fouache (1774-1780), Paris date letter M for 1775, in an associated velvet-lined leather case stamped: ‘Au Vieux Paris / Bonnefoy & Cie / 4, Rue de la Paix'
5.3cm., 2 1/8. in. diameter
